You can get Java games for the Fusion at getjar.com. I've already found and installed about a dozen. I'm disappointed that the installed Java games went away when I reformatted the internal memory.

If you run Windows and have a tv tuner card you can capture video that will play on the Fusion. I have thousands of hours captured and burned to discs and now I have a portable player for my shows. I think the online digital movie rentals will also work since it supports Digital Rights Management.

I probably won't load pictures but that is a nice feature. I have purchased WMA music that I was able to load using WMP9 even though the instructions seem to say WMP10 is needed.
